#1f8e1a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1f8e1a is composed of 12.2% red, 55.7% green and 10.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.7%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 117.4 degrees, a saturation of 69% and a lightness of 32.9%. #1f8e1a color hex could be obtained by blending #3eff34 with #001d00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#1f8e1a color description : Dark lime green.

#1f8e1a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1f8e1a has RGB values of R:31, G:142, B:26 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0, Y:0.82,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 2067994.

Shades and Tints of #1f8e1a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020902 is the darkest color, while #f8fef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1f8e1a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e5a4e is the less saturated color, while #07a800 is the most saturated one.
